GeographyCase studiesA2/A-levelOCR Created by: berraCreated on: 12-04-16 20:42 The Van Earthquake - Turkey ... 1 of 22 When? 23rd Oct 2011 2 of 22 What 3 plates is is situated next to? The Anatolian, the Arabian and the Eurasian 3 of 22 Where was the epicenter? 30km away from the city of Van 4 of 22 How deep was the focus? 7.2km 5 of 22 Why was Lake Van a problem? It caused soil liquefaction along the shore which lead to greater ground motions 6 of 22 Deaths? 604 7 of 22 Injured? 4,150 8 of 22 How many homeless? 160,000 9 of 22 How many orphans? 155 10 of 22 How many aid trucks were looted? 17 11 of 22 What was the cost of insurance payouts? $80 million 12 of 22 How much of the GDP was expected to be lost? 30-60% 13 of 22 What did the clean up operation cost? $6-10 billion 14 of 22 What is the HDI of Van? 6.5 15 of 22 How much were AFAD (Emergency response unit) given? $7 million 16 of 22 How many personnel did AFAD have? 1,275 17 of 22 How many generators did AFAD have? 46 18 of 22 How many blankets did AFAD give? 109,000 19 of 22 How many countries gave aid? 27 20 of 22 What type of medical personnel were trained to help how many? 38 psychiatrists were trained to help those left with nothing 21 of 22 What was activated by the minitstry of health? SAKOM - The emergency and crisis coordination centre who gave out relief and checked structures 22 of 22
